Metal Oxide–Polymer Bulk Heterojunction Solar Cells

W.J. Beek, Martijn M. Wienk, René A. J. Janssen

Open publisher page 2 citations

Abstract

This chapter contains sections titled: Introduction Planar Metal Oxide–Polymer Bilayer Cells Filling Nanoporous and Nanostructured Metal Oxides with Conjugated Polymers Nanoparticle–Polymer Hybrid Solar Cells Metal Oxide Networks and Conjugated Polymers Conclusions and Outlook References
